Healthcare: In medical settings, gas analyzers are used to measure the concentration of gases in breath, blood, and other bodily fluids. As an illustration, they can be used to monitor oxygen and carbon dioxide ranges in affected person breath or blood gas evaluation. Carbon Dioxide Levels (pCO2):The partial stress of carbon dioxide (pCO2) measurement gives information about the body’s ability to eradicate carbon dioxide via respiration. Abnormal pCO2 levels can point out respiratory issues, resembling hypoventilation or hyperventilation, and help in adjusting ventilation methods accordingly. Lactate Levels:Some blood fuel analyzers can also measure lactate levels, that are elevated in circumstances similar to sepsis, shock, or tissue hypoxia.Monitoring lactate helps determine patients susceptible to organ failure and guides remedy strategies. Benchtop Blood Fuel Analyzers:Benchtop blood fuel analyzers are bigger, excessive-efficiency instruments primarily found in clinical laboratories and hospitals. These analyzers provide an extensive vary of testing parameters, together with pH, pO2, pCO2, electrolytes, and more. Benchtop analyzers often come geared up with automated features for sample handling, mixing, and calibration, allowing for high-throughput testing. Photoionization Detectors (PIDs): PIDs use ultraviolet mild to ionize fuel molecules, permitting for the detection of vol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and different gases. They are extensively used in industrial hygiene and environmental monitoring. Gas Chromatography (GC) Analyzers: GC analyzers separate gases in a pattern using a column after which detect and quantify the separated parts. They're extremely versatile and might analyze a wide range of gases. Understanding the working principles of gas analyzers is crucial for selecting the precise instrument for a selected utility. Common working ideas embrace absorption of particular wavelengths of light, ionization of gas molecules, and separation of gasoline elements based mostly on their physical and chemical properties. Electrochemical measuring cells are relatively inexpensive and require no supply voltage. Disadvantages are the comparatively quick lifetime at too excessive oxygen concentrations, and a relatively long response time or measurement time. In addition, газоанализаторы a frequent calibration of the gas analyzer is critical. With paramagnetic measuring cells, a protracted-term stable measuring signal with long calibration intervals may be achieved. Since it is a physical measurement precept, the cells have a long service life. Analyzing air pollution is step one towards preserving a clean atmospheric surroundings.
